Breaking Barriers is a youth-led initiative addressing gender inequity in sports through storytelling, policy analysis, and on-ground action. Using basketball as both a lens and a tool, the project amplifies women’s voices, challenges systemic bias, and creates inclusive spaces for girls in sport—rooted in the Hong Kong context and informed by global best practices.

COMMUNITY SERVICE

Empowerment Through Sport

Free basketball clinics for girls in underserved communities, integrating sport with confidence-building conversations.

Structure of Each Clinic (1 Hour)

  • On-Court Skills: Fundamentals, drills, teamwork

  • Empowerment Circle: Body image, mental health, challenging stereotypes

Impact Goals

  • Increase girls’ participation and confidence in sports

  • Create safe, supportive sporting spaces

  • Build long-term interest in athletics and leadership
